Expanding Knowledge Of Cloud Computing Models

As operations management becomes increasingly technology-driven, understanding cloud computing models is essential for optimizing organizational workflows and infrastructure. Knowledge of public, private, and hybrid cloud solutions allows operations managers to make informed decisions about system deployment, cost efficiency, and scalability, all of which directly impact operational performance. Public cloud solutions offer rapid provisioning and flexible resources, while private clouds emphasize security and control. Hybrid models combine these benefits, providing strategic advantages for businesses with mixed requirements. Integrating cloud expertise into operations ensures that teams can collaborate seamlessly, scale processes quickly, and reduce downtime caused by infrastructure limitations. Recognizing Social Engineering Risks In Operations

Social engineering represents one of the most prevalent human-centered security threats in operational environments. Unlike technical exploits, social engineering targets human behavior, leveraging manipulation and deception to gain unauthorized access to sensitive systems or information. Operations managers who understand these tactics can implement awareness programs, procedural safeguards, and verification protocols that reduce vulnerabilities. Effective mitigation strategies include regular employee training, simulated phishing exercises, and a culture of accountability and verification. Leveraging Decision Matrices For Operational Choices

In operations management, complex decisions often involve multiple variables, conflicting priorities, and high stakes. Utilizing decision matrices enables managers to systematically evaluate options, assign weights to critical criteria, and prioritize actions based on measurable outcomes. This method reduces cognitive bias and ensures that choices align with strategic objectives, enhancing both efficiency and accountability. Operations leaders use decision matrices to assess investments, evaluate process improvements, or select technology solutions, providing a structured approach to problem-solving. Learning to apply this tool effectively strengthens analytical thinking and supports consistent, transparent decision-making across teams. Using S-Curve Analysis In Project Management

Advanced operations managers rely on analytical tools to track performance, forecast outcomes, and guide decision-making across complex initiatives. One such tool is the S-curve, which visualizes project progress over time by comparing planned versus actual performance. Understanding this concept helps operations leaders assess efficiency, resource utilization, and schedule adherence throughout a project lifecycle. The S-curve enables managers to identify early warning signs of delays or cost overruns, allowing for timely corrective action.
